I already own the Marquis reagent. I want to get one of the new and improved kits. But I am not sure which is better, DanceSafe or EZ Test.
The DanceSafe kit has the Mecke and Simon's reagents with another unnamed bottle. The EZ Test has Simon's and Robadope reagents with something called a FIXER. So which is actually the most effective kit?
 
It all depends on what you want to test for.
I'm glad to hear you still have a Marquis kit. This should always be the first kit you use. Other kits should be used in conjunction with Marquis, and the results cross-referenced.
Mecke, the new Dancesafe kit, is the best kit for differentiating between MDxx and DXM. If you are in North America then this might be a good idea for you to have, as this seems to be a common adulterant there.
EZ Test Xtreme, which contains Marquis as well, has Simon's and Robadope. The fixer is just a common chemical used both in the Simon's and Robadope tests. Simon's is really only good for determining if you have MDA or MDMA/MDEA, or if your "speed" is amphetamine or methamphetamine. Using all three kits together can give an indication of wether or not your pill contains a mixture of PMA and MDxx, which has been seen in Europe and Australia.
So you need to ask yourself what are your priorities when choosing a kit; DXM? PMA? MDA?
